Stamford (Lincs) to Port Sunlight by train

Considering a train trip from Stamford (Lincs) to Port Sunlight? The journey typically lasts around 4hrs 45 mins and spans about 115 miles (185 kilometres). With approximately 17 trains running each day, you're spoiled for choice when scheduling your travel. By booking your tickets in advance, you could secure fares starting from just £90.80, making it a budget-friendly option for smart travelers.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Stamford (Lincs) to Port Sunlight start from £90.80 one way, or £92.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Stamford (Lincs) to Port Sunlight are available for £99.20 one way, or £135.80 return

Station Facilities and Accessibility

At Stamford (Lincs) train station, you will find a variety of facilities to cater to your needs. The ticket office operates from early morning until mid-afternoon, making it convenient for you to purchase or collect tickets. Ticket machines are available for ease of service, though there's no accessible ticket machine at this time. For those utilizing smartcards, validators are present, but issuance happens elsewhere.

Accessibility at Stamford is notable, with step-free access available to the Peterborough-bound platform. However, keep in mind that access to the Leicester-bound platform is via a footbridge, meaning step-free options are limited. Toilets, including accessible ones, are conveniently located in the waiting rooms on Platforms 1 and 2 and are also equipped with baby changing facilities.

Shopping, Food, and Wi-Fi

While Stamford (Lincs) station does not house eateries, ATMs, or shops, its proximity to the town means local amenities are just a stone's throw away. Bear in mind that public Wi-Fi isn't available at the station, so make sure to plan accordingly if you require internet access during your journey.

Port Sunlight Station Amenities

Although Port Sunlight station may not be a bustling metropolis, it offers several essential amenities to ensure a smooth travel experience. The station's ticket office is open from early morning until late at night, allowing travelers the flexibility to plan their trips outside the typical rush hours. Online ticket purchasers will be pleased to know that they can collect their tickets directly from the ticket office. However, it’s worth noting that there are no electronic ticket machines available or accessible ticket machines for those with limited mobility.

The station is equipped with a dependable induction loop system, aiding those with hearing impairments, and smartcard holders can easily tap and travel due to the presence of smartcard validators. One should note that while basic facilities are available, the station lacks a waiting room, cafés, and shops, which presents a chance for quiet reflection or perhaps engaging with fellow passengers.

Access and Assistance

Unfortunately, Port Sunlight station does not provide step-free access, making it difficult for travelers with restricted mobility to use the platforms. However, the staff are committed to providing help, with personnel available throughout most of the day to assist and answer queries. For those requiring special assistance, you can request support in advance, ensuring a personalized and accessible experience.

For those traveling by bike, Port Sunlight station offers robust bicycle storage facilities with CCTV monitoring, meaning cyclists can securely park their bikes and continue their journey via train.
